2025-11-05 17:01:42 +08:00
|
|
|
<script lang="ts" setup>
|
|
|
|
|
import type { Article } from './types';
|
|
|
|
|
|
2025-11-07 17:58:24 +08:00
|
|
|
import { WxNews } from '#/views/mp/modules/wx-news';
|
2025-11-05 17:01:42 +08:00
|
|
|
|
|
|
|
|
defineOptions({ name: 'DraftTableCell' });
|
|
|
|
|
|
|
|
|
|
const props = defineProps<{
|
|
|
|
|
row: Article;
|
|
|
|
|
}>();
|
|
|
|
|
</script>
|
|
|
|
|
|
|
|
|
|
<template>
|
|
|
|
|
<div class="draft-content">
|
|
|
|
|
<div v-if="props.row.content && props.row.content.newsItem">
|
|
|
|
|
<WxNews :articles="props.row.content.newsItem" />
|
|
|
|
|
</div>
|
|
|
|
|
</div>
|
|
|
|
|
</template>
|
|
|
|
|
|
|
|
|
|
<style lang="scss" scoped>
|
|
|
|
|
.draft-content {
|
|
|
|
|
padding: 10px;
|
|
|
|
|
}
|
|
|
|
|
</style>
|